POSITION SUMMARY
The Administrative Coordinator will be a highly organized, detail-oriented, and proactive individual who is passionate about supporting a mission-driven nonprofit. This part-time role will play a key role in ensuring the day-to-day administrative operations of Virginia Women and Family Support Center run smoothly and efficiently. The Administrative Coordinator will support internal systems, communications, scheduling, and general office operations while assisting multiple departments as needed. This position is ideal for someone who thrives in a fast-paced environment, enjoys keeping things organized, and wants to be part of meaningful work that directly impacts women and children experiencing homelessness. This is a 20-hour per week part-time position that reports directly to the Executive Director.
ESSENTIAL FUNCTION/RESPONSIBILITIES
(include, but are not limited to) Administrative Support 50% Manage daily administrative operations to ensure efficiency across the organization Maintain organized digital and physical filing systems Assist with scheduling meetings, appointments, and organizational events Support internal communications and coordination across departments Prepare documents, reports, and presentations as needed Monitor and respond to general email and phone inquiries Order and maintain office supplies and inventory Operations & Coordination 30% Assist in coordinating logistics for programs, events, and meetings Support volunteer coordination efforts including scheduling and communication Help maintain calendars for organizational activities and key deadlines Work with staff to ensure timely completion of projects and administrative needs Provide support for special projects and organizational initiatives Data & Systems Management 15% Enter and maintain accurate data across internal systems and databases Assist with tracking key organizational metrics and reporting Maintain confidentiality and integrity of organizational records Support basic database management tasks as needed Other Responsibilities - 5% Provide energy, professionalism, and commitment to VAWFSC's mission, values, and integrity Assist with general administrative duties as needed Be available and willing to perform other tasks as assigned
QUALIFICATIONS AND EXPERIENCE
Strong organizational skills with exceptional attention to detail Excellent written and verbal communication skills Ability to manage multiple tasks, prioritize effectively, and meet deadlines Self-motivated, reliable, and able to work independently with minimal supervision Strong interpersonal skills and ability to work collaboratively across teams High level of professionalism, discretion, and confidentiality Comfortable in a fast-paced, mission-driven environment Proficiency in Google Workspace (Docs, Sheets, Drive, Calendar) Experience with administrative support, office coordination, or similar roles preferred Experience working in a nonprofit environment is a plus
DESIRED K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S, ABILITIES
Strong problem-solving and critical thinking skills Ability to anticipate needs and take initiative Strong time management and organizational systems Ability to communicate effectively with diverse audiences including staff, volunteers, and community partners Adaptability and willingness to take on a variety of tasks Commitment to supporting a positive and collaborative team culture
REQUIREMENTS
High school diploma required; Associate's or Bachelor's degree preferred Minimum of 1-2 years of administrative or office support experience Proficient in Google Suites and general office tools Comfortable working both independently and as part of a team Ability to multitask in a busy environment A passion for the organization's mission Must pass a background check
